Hi,

rtai_oldnames.h in magma-CVS is broken. This patch fixes it for x86, other architectures may require a check as well.

With this patch applied, RTnet at least loads on top of magma now.

Jan
? GNUmakefile
? oldnames.patch
Index: rtai_oldnames.h
===================================================================
RCS file: /cvs/rtai/magma/base/include/asm-i386/rtai_oldnames.h,v
retrieving revision 1.4
diff -u -p -r1.4 rtai_oldnames.h
--- rtai_oldnames.h     5 Jan 2005 16:48:31 -0000       1.4
+++ rtai_oldnames.h     21 Mar 2005 16:36:29 -0000
@@ -37,9 +37,9 @@
 #define IFLAG                        RTAI_IFLAG
 #define hard_cli()                   rtai_cli()
 #define hard_sti()                   rtai_sti()
-#define hard_save_flags_and_cli(x)   rtai_local_irq_save(x)
-#define hard_restore_flags(x)        rtai_local_irq_restore(x)
-#define hard_save_flags(x)           rtai_local_irq_flags(x)
+#define hard_save_flags_and_cli(x)   rtai_save_flags_and_cli(x)
+#define hard_restore_flags(x)        rtai_restore_flags(x)
+#define hard_save_flags(x)           rtai_save_flags(x)
 #define hard_cpu_id                  adeos_processor_id
 
 #endif /* __KERNEL__ */

Reply via email to